![]() The parcel is targeting a stabilized yield of 6.8% when fully complete. ![]() The key components are the community program and accommodation design that creates a full immersion into Disney’s motto for the program: living, learning, earning.ĪCC holds a ground lease for Flamingo Crossings Village and owns and manages the apartments. In 2017, Disney contacted ACC to begin discussions that ultimately led the company to programming, designing, developing, owning, and managing the fully-integrated community for the 10,000-plus Disney Internships & Programs participants.īayless says ACC took the core competencies that have made it successful in student housing and applied them to a new concept that was realized in Flamingo Crossings Village. “My dorm at Morehouse College didn’t have health, wellness, and recreational amenities that are anything like what we have here.” “Living here is like living in a mini-resort,” says Daquan Spratley, a former participant who now works as a resident experience specialist at Flamingo Crossings Village. The collaboration between Disney and ACC extends to details such as the unit designs, the connection to adjacent retail development, and the amenity mix that gives residents their own Disney resort experience, says William Talbot, chief investment officer of ACC.Īs for the residents at Flamingo Crossings Village, enthusiasm prevails. While the occupants are a similar demographic to the college students ACC serves in other locations, these participants are also immersed into Disney culture through their program experience. The apartments are located in close proximity to Walt Disney World Resort®. Here, participants have access to resort-style amenities, including a fitness center, social lounges and recreation spaces. While there’s a parallel to student housing, he explains that Flamingo Crossings Village has an immense scale with approximately 10,000 beds and about 50,000 square feet of state-of-the art amenity space situated on 150 acres leased from Disney. “There’s nothing really like this anywhere else,” Bayless says. He explains that before Disney brought the REIT in to develop the community, Disney Internships & Programs participants were housed in traditional garden-style apartments.Īs the largest owner, manager, and developer of student housing in the United States, ACC has plenty of experience creating communities for students, but this project and the close partnership with Disney was different. “We wanted to create a customer experience for participants that emulates what they create for their guests,” says Bill Bayless, CEO of ACC. ![]() Typical program lengths range from one semester to 12 months. This paid internship opportunity allows participants to work at the Walt Disney World® Resort in a variety of operating roles. Disney Internships & Programs includes the Disney College Program, Disney International Program, and Disney Culinary Program. (NYSE: ACC) is happy to be responsible for the place they call their home away from home.įlamingo Crossings Village is a purpose-built multifamily community within the Flamingo Crossings mixed-use development in Winter Garden, Florida.
